Flukes!

Body and gill flukes are worm-like, fatter at one end. Flukes movement is alternate, jerky elongation and contraction.

Flukes elimination will require entire pond treatment for all the fish in the pond:

  • Organophosphate for Flukes!
  • “Fluke Tabs” contains an organophosphate as its active ingredient. It is also effective against anchor worm and fish lice. Aquarium Products produces “Fluke Tabs”.

    Day 1 – Add 1 tablet per 10 gallons

    Day 2 – No treatment

    Day 3 – Add 1 tablet per 10 gallons

    Day 4 – 50% pond water change

    Day 5 – Optional 3rd tablet treatment. Two usually sufficient

    Day 6 – 50% pond water change, if 3rd treatment is necessary

  • Alternative Treatment for Flukes!


  • Argent’s Trichloracide is another organophosphate effective against flukes. 100 grams treats 8,000 gallons. It’s very cost effective treatment and highly recommended.
